Special Edition CFO Virtual Roundtable -- hosted by FEI Long Island in partnership with the FEI New Jersey & FEI Connecticut Chapters

Open to C-Suite and Senior Financial Executives

Join us during this series as we connect, communicate, and collaborate on ideas, problems and solutions financial executives are similarly experiencing throughout multiple industries. Each virtual session will include hot-topic roundtable discussions and some sessions will also include featured speakers. Benjamin Horowitz, originator of this collaborative virtual series, will host each Roundtable and steer us through the complexities and challenges multi-industry financial executives are facing. Our goal is to help collectively achieve connection and clarity in the similar challenges we are facing and to discover new innovations and fresh financial insight through discussions within the CFO community.

This special edition CFO Virtual Roundtable will be hosted by FEI Long Island in partnership with FEI New Jersey & FEI Connecticut. The guest speaker for this event is from 
Alliance Cost Containment 


Topics for discussion include: 

  • How much of a negative impact has COVID had on your bottom line?

  • How do you know if your suppliers are giving you their best pricing?

  • Are you scrutinizing pricing from the suppliers you’re utilizing?

  • How can small to mid-size organizations leverage buying power with suppliers to drive down pricing?

  • Do you not have the time to enter into a cost containment project?
